So Megamind was my first film of 2011. Better late than never. I used a Cineworld voucher that ran out next week, and I'm really delighted I saw this film. I went for the 2D version and didn't feel I missed out on anything.
I enjoyed the voiceover at the start, which I thought was a funny take on Superman and a nice way of easing me into the film.
I've read reviews criticising it for not being funny enough, but I thought there was plenty of humour and enough sight gags to keep me entertained without detracting from story and characterisation.
I preferred this to Despicable Me. The voices were better done (no confusing accents) and I was more interested in the superhero storyline.
I thoroughly enjoyed watching this, and would recommend it for kids and bigger kids. I was the only person in the screening today!
8/10

i think people would compare Megamind and Despicable Me, they were both very watchable with their similar themes. I think where Megamind disappoints abit more and did less well at the box office was the surprising lack of screen time/voice over time for Brad Pitt, despite it being advertised heavily as a Will Ferrell and Brad Pitt voiceover. Instead we get alot more of Jonah Hill.
And obviously it didn't help that it came out after Despicable Me, so some of the box office draw was taken away.
Nevertheless I liked the bad guy is actually the good guy storyline and less emphasis on the companies to make cuddly characters to sell more dolls or use as ideas for theme parks. (or are there Megamind dolls already?
)
7.5/10
